Rosa Salazar will no longer lead CBS‘ “Einstein” alongside Matthew Gray Gubler.
The news arrives approximately a week since CBS approved the drama series, and shortly following their decision to move it from the 2025-2026 TV season to the subsequent 2026-2027 season. According to our sources, Salazar asked for her contract to be terminated when she found out about the production delay, and both parties consented to her request.
Title character, Lewis Einstein, portrayed by Matthew Gray Gubler, is Albert Einstein’s great grandson. He leads a comfortable life as a university professor until his rebellious behavior gets him into legal trouble. As a result, he’s drafted to assist a local detective in solving her most confounding cases. Lewis is depicted as being impudent and off-course, frequently skipping classes due to the burden of his genius and renowned name.

Salazar was slated to portray Veronica “Ronni” Paris, a dedicated detective inspector for the New Jersey State Police. After the passing of her husband, she chose a career in law enforcement. Known for her keen intellect and strict discipline, Ronni pushes herself and her peers to their limits, yet grapples with feelings of unease when it comes to collaborating with professor Einstein.
The television show “Einstein” is created by Andy Breckman and directed by Randy Zisk. Alongside Tariq Jalil, Rose Hughes, Rodrigo Herrera Ibarguengoytia, and Laura Beetz, they all serve as executive producers for Seven One Studios International. CBS Studios are the ones who produce it.
The show originates from a well-received German television film in 2015, which eventually grew into a widely appreciated three-season series. In the summer of 2024, the CBS remake was commissioned for production as a pilot episode.
